Application This document shows the description of wattmeter(hereinafter called meter)and mounted communication board(hereinafter called module). - target meters : GE I210+ Meter FM1S / FM2S / FM12S / FM25S - Module : Fujitsu WR-2012-00a-MM 2. System Configuration Fig2-1 is general system configuration of using meter. Installed meters in each house is communicated to Center via Relay equipments and Concentrators and control the meter-reading value etc.automatically. Red line of Fig.2-1 is the applicable scope of this document. Fig2-1 System configuration Substation Poles Houses ..... Center Server - DHCP Server Router Router Fiber-opt network Switch Meters Relay equipments Concentrator User manual 5/10 3. Description of Meter (Host) 3.1 Overview Form and overview of meter are as follows. Category Meter form Remark FM1S FM2S FM12S FM25S Input voltage 120VAC 240VAC 120VAC or 240VAC 120VAC or 240VAC enclosure Same form Meter panel board Same board Meter socket type Different type Mouted module Same module meter panel interface Same interface AC power cable Same cable 3.2 Operating Range • Voltage : + - 20% (or ±20%) • Temperature : -40°C through +85°C • Typical Starting Watts : <=5.0 Watts (Form 2S 240V CL200) • Typical Watts Loss : 0.7 Watts • Typical Accuracy : Within +/- 0.2% User manual 6/10 4. Description of Module ( Module) 4.1 Overview The module mounted to each meter in paragraph 3 collects the meter-reading values etc. with controlling Center. 4.2 Operating Range Same as chapter 3.2. 4.3 Major element Major elements of module are as follows. FCC ID: O4D-2012-003-SNB IC: 10402A-12003SNB Produkte Products RF Exposure Statement: 12029438 002 Page 1 of 1 Client: Fujitsu Limited Shiodome City Center, 1-5-2 Higashi-Shimbashi, Minato-ku, Tokyo 105-7123, Japan Test item: Communication Module Identification: WR-2012-00a-MM FCC Requirement According to FCC 2.1091, mobile equipment must comply with the following applicable limit for maximum permissible exposure (MPE) specified in FCC 1.1310: Equipment Use Frequency Range Power Density [mW/cm 2 ] Average Time [min] General Population / Uncontrolled Exposure 1.5 – 100GHz 1 30 IC Requirement According to RSS-102 (Issue 4), clause 2.5.2, no routine RF exposure evaluation is required if the transmitter has a minimum separation distance to the user greater than 20cm and has an output power (e.i.r.p.) below the following threshold: Frequency Range RF Exp. Evaluation Threshold [W] Above 1.5GHz 5 Measurement Result The maximum measured transmitter power is given in the following table: Conducted Output Power P out [mW] Maximum Antenna Gain [dBi] EIRP Output Power [mW] Power Density at 20cm [mW/cm 2 ] 191.87 2.9 374.11 0.074 Note: The power density S in mW/cm 2 is calculated according to the Friis formula: S = (P out · G) / (4π · D 2 ), where P out = antenna conducted output power in mW, G = antenna gain in linear scale (here: 2.9dBi = 1.95 linear), D = distance between observation point and radiating structure in cm (here: 20cm). Conclusion The device complies with the FCC and IC RF exposure requirements since the maximum transmitter power density is below the FCC limit and the e.i.r.p. output power is below the IC RF exposure evaluation exemption threshold. Limited Modular Approval. The output power listed is conducted. This Module is approved only for installation in devices under control of the grantee and only for models indicated in this filing. This module must not be incorporated into any other device or system without retesting and authorization under a Class II Permissive Change. This transmitter must be installed to provide a separation distance of at least 20 cm from all persons and must not be co-located or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ter. End-users must be provided with transmitter operation conditions for satisfying RF exposure compliance.
